Julianne MacLean is a Canadian romance novelist, primarily historical romance. She lives in Nova Scotia.

Maclean earned a BA in English Literature from the University of King’s College in year 1987. She went back to school to study the accounting and received a BA in the Business Administration with a minor in Accounting in year 1992. She worked in the Auditor General’s Office before retiring to concentrate on writing her romance novels. She sold his first novel, Prairie Bride, to Harlequin in year 1999.

In year 2005, her novel Love According to Lily won the Romantic Times Critics’ Choice Award for the Best Historical Romance.

Julianne MacLean is a USA Today bestselling author with over forty novels including the Color of the Sky series. His most recent publication, THESE TANGLED VINES, was one of Amazon’s best-selling Kindle eBooks of year 2021. Readers have described her books as the “breathtaking,” “moving,” and “uplifting.” MacLean is a four-time RITA finalist and has won the numerous awards, including Booksellers’ Best Bookstore Award and Romantic Times Critics’ Choice Award. His novels have sold millions of copies worldwide and have been published in more than a dozen languages.

MacLean holds a bachelor’s degree in English Literature from King’s College in Halifax, Nova Scotia and a bachelor’s degree in business administration from Acadia University in Wolfville, Nova Scotia. She loves to travel and has lived in the New Zealand, Canada and England. MacLean currently lives with her husband on the East Coast of Canada in a lake house.

Olivia Hamilton is married woman who married to the love of her life, Dean, a charismatic pilot who flies private jets for the rich and famous. But when he disappears into the Bermuda Triangle, Olivia’s idyllic existence falls apart. After years of waiting, Olivia must finally give up the fragile hope that her loving husband is still alive.

Melanie Brown is a particle physicist who spends her nights studying the Bermuda Triangle. But his research interests falter when his mother dies in a tragic accident. Struggling to get her life and career back on track, Melanie embarks on a forbidden love affair with her therapist.

When a shocking discovery shows that Olivia and Melanie’s paths are intertwined, it sheds new light on Dean’s disappearance. The two women’s uncanny bond threatens to reveal secrets that will change everything Olivia thought she knew about her marriage, her husband and most importantly, herself.
